Assetmark Inc. Buys 3,140 Shares of iShares U.S. Infrastructure ETF (BATS:IFRA)

Assetmark Inc. grew its stake in iShares U.S. Infrastructure ETF (BATS:IFRAFree Report) by 19.9%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 18,948 shares of the company’s stock after purchasing an additional 3,140 shares during the quarter. Assetmark Inc.’s holdings in iShares U.S. Infrastructure ETF were worth $877,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

iShares U.S. Infrastructure ETF Company Profile

The iShares U.S. Infrastructure ETF (IFRA)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the NYSE FactSet U.S. Infrastructure index. The fund tracks an index of US-listed infrastructure companies that derive a significant portion of their revenue from within the US. IFRA was launched on Apr 3, 2018 and is managed by BlackRock.
